There are three types of wine white, red, and rose. White wine is made by using only the juice during the fermentation process. Red wine uses the whole grape during fermentation. Rose wine is made by extracting the skins after the fermentation has begun resulting in a pinkish tone. Two other important facts to know about wine are dry and sweet. Dry wine is made by allowing the grape sugar to ferment longer in the process. Sweet wine is made just the opposite, the fermentation process is not as long resulting in a sweeter product. There are four different types of wine these are natural, sparkling, fortified, and aromatized. Natural wines are the result of the alcohol content coming directly from the fermentation process. Champagne is also a type of wine, however it is imperative to note that Champagne is a wine that comes only from that region of France. All other bubbly is referred to as sparkling wine. Fortified wine has a higher alcohol content, sherry, port, and madeira are examples of fortified wine. The final category is aromatized wines which consists of vermouths and aperitifs.

Spirits or liquors are drinks that are made using a distillation process where wines and beer are made by fermentation. Spirits have a considerably higher alcohol content than wines. When speaking about the alcohol content it is referred to as the proof, the proof is derived by multiplying the percentage of alcohol by two. Therefore a beverage containing forty percent alcohol would be eighty proof. There are too many types of liquors to cover here, so we will stick to the basics.
